The bearings of ships A and B from a port P are 225° and 116° respectively. Ship A is 3.9km from ship B on a bearing of 258°.

Answer:

  • 2.54 km

Step-by-step explanation:

<em>See the attached</em>

All given details are reflected in the diagram (not to scale)

  • PA is at 225°, PB is at 116°, BA is at 258°
  • AB = 3.9 km
  • AP = x
  • m∠P = 225° - 116° = 109°
  • m∠A = 258° - 225° = 33°
  • m∠B = 180° - (109° + 33°) = 38°

<u>Use the law of sines:</u>

  • x/ sin 38° = 3.9 / sin 109°
  • x = 3.9 sin 38° / sin 109°
  • x = 2.54 km (rounded)

Find the missing angle.
Sphinxa [80]

Answer:

m\angle XYV=135^{\circ}

Step-by-step explanation:

Notice that m\angle XYV=m\angle XYW+m\angle VYW.

The diagram already marks m\angle VYW=80^{\circ}, so we just need to find m\angle XYW.

\angle TYU and \angle XYW are vertical angles, which means they are equal in measure.

Therefore,

m\angle TYU=m\angle XYW=6x+7

Since there are 180^{\circ} on each side of a line, we have the following equation:

m\angle XYW+m\angle VYW+m\angle UYV=180^{\circ},\\6x+7+13+4x+80=180,\\10x+20=100,\\10x=80,\\x=8.

Plugging in x=8, we have:

m\angle XYW=6(8)+7=55^{\circ}.

Therefore,

m\angle XYV=55^{\circ}+80^{\circ},\\m\angle XYV=\fbox{$135^{\circ}$}.
